contents We prove that the derived category of a branched double cover is equivalent to a category of matrix factorizations for a fiberwise quadratic potential on the associated line bundle. This requires the linear fiber coordinate to have odd cohomological degree, so we work with matrix factorizations which no longer have the traditional splitting into even and odd parts.
